Allen Johnson Wins Again, Takes Commanding Lead in NHRA Pro Stock Points Race
Allen Johnson continued his domination in the NHRA Pro Stock countdown to one, winning his sixth event of the season and 15th of his career with a performance of 6.637 at 208.17 in his Team Mopar Dodge Avenger to outrun Vincent Nobile in the final round. SEMA Mustang Powered by Women Unveiled at 2012 SEMA Show
The SEMA Mustang Build Powered By Women, better known as “High Gear,” debuted in the Ford Motor Co. booth Tuesday at the 2012 SEMA Show in Las Vegas, NV.
